html5代码案例分析 html5代码中有一个id,id="tuo",还有一个ondragstart="drag(event)"属性,那么这个是表示的什么意思呢,它后面有一个函数drag(event),这个意思就是表示我们开始拖动的时候调用这个函数,我们可以看到这里dragstart,它就是表示我们 ...
分类:
Web程序 时间:
2018-06-14 01:15:21
阅读次数:
263
拖动这个HTML5 的 API 在 pc端支持率还是蛮高的,有99.97% ; 这个API 有针对""被拖动元素"" 和 ""放置目标区" 对应的两种拖动事件 被拖动元素: 1. dragstart 这个事件触发在用户按下鼠标开始拖动这个元素或者文本选中的时候 2. drag 当用户拖动一个元素或者 ...
分类:
Web程序 时间:
2018-05-18 13:54:51
阅读次数:
283
react 拖拽排序。项目中用到了,记一笔。没有用react-dnd, 没有用react-beautiful-dnd, 因为需求简单,所以就自己撸了一个。 代码很简单 定义css, 两个动画 一个是向上拖拽的动画,一个是向下拖拽的样式。 2.写组件 解释几个三个方法1.dragStart 把 tar ...
分类:
编程语言 时间:
2018-04-26 19:55:44
阅读次数:
2222
火狐浏览器实现拖拽有2个坑: 1、在dragstart事件中,必须要使用ev.dataTransfer.setData(),否则,即使在html中设置了元素 draggable=true,拖拽也是无效的。 2、火狐拖放后,总会默认打开百度搜索,如果是图片,则会打开图片。 解决办法: 在drop事件中 ...
分类:
其他好文 时间:
2018-02-11 12:34:33
阅读次数:
366
*** 通过拖拽事件,可以控制拖放相关的各个方面*** 拖动某元素时,将依次触发下列事件:1)dragstart 2)drag 3)dragend 拖动开始:ondragstart 拖拽过程:ondrag 拖拽停止:ondragend 当某个元素被拖动到放置目标上,将依次触发下列事件:1)drage ...
分类:
其他好文 时间:
2018-01-22 15:16:37
阅读次数:
220
avalon 触屏 事件 tap, longtap, doubletap swipe, swipeleft, swiperight,swipedown,swipeup pinch, pinchstart,pinchend,pinchin,pinchout drag,dragstart,dragend ...
分类:
移动开发 时间:
2017-09-12 23:13:34
阅读次数:
291
被拖拽元素有关的事件 dragstart: 当拖拽元素被拖动离开原位置触发。dragend: 档松开鼠标,停止拖拽时触发。 目标元素有关事件 dragenter: 拖拽元素进入目标元素区域触发。dragover:拖拽元素在目标元素上移动触发。drop:拖拽元素在目标元素上松开鼠标停止拖拽时触发。 P ...
分类:
Web程序 时间:
2017-08-30 17:37:06
阅读次数:
244
拖放(Drag 和 drop)是 HTML5 标准的组成部分。 // http://www.w3school.com.cn/html5/html_5_draganddrop.asp dataTransfer.setData() 方法设置被拖数据的数据类型和值 dragstart :当被拖拽元素开始被 ...
分类:
Web程序 时间:
2017-08-15 10:12:31
阅读次数:
173
document.ondragover = function (e) { e.preventDefault(); }; document.ondrop = function (e) { e.preventDefault(); }; $(document).on("dragstart", functi... ...
分类:
其他好文 时间:
2017-07-28 18:26:22
阅读次数:
191
一、draggable属性 如果想要网页上的元素能拖动,则需要把元素的draggable属性设为true ps:有些浏览器中,a元素和img元素默认是可以拖动的,但最好还是加上该属性。 二、拖动的事件 1.加在拖动元素的事件大概有如下: (1)dragstart:网页元素开始拖动时触发。 (2)dr ...
分类:
Web程序 时间:
2017-06-09 21:30:52
阅读次数:
266